Axel Braun to Crowdfund 'Empire,' Distribute Free

LOS ANGELES—In true Rebel spirit, director Axel Braun launches an offensive against the Dark Side of porn piracy with his unprecedented plan for producing and distributing his biggest venture yet, The Empire Strikes Back: An Axel Braun Parody—to crowdfund the project entirely via website Indiegogo.com and release it completely free of charge.

"I'm trying to do something that has never been done," Braun said of the long-awaited followup to his mega-blockbuster Star Wars XXX. "I want to make the most amazing porn parody ever, completely funded by fans and sponsors, and I'm going to give it away for free. There will be no DVDs; it will only be available online, and it will be free for everyone. Forever.

"No hidden gimmicks, no need to give out your email address, no membership, absolutely nothing but click and watch," Braun continued. "Full HD, and fully legal. It's my way to fight internet piracy while giving back to the fans, and it's a bit of a social experiment."

The Indiegogo campaign, which has a goal of raising $500,000 by April 22, has been set as one with "fixed funding" parameters, meaning that Indiegogo will hold all funds raised and if the goal is not met by the deadline, they will be automatically refunded.

"It's all or nothing," Braun explained. "We either reach our goal or I will never shoot the movie. I want to see if there are enough fans around the world who want this movie to happen as much as I do, and I just don't want to see pirates profit from it."

Asked what his response would be to those who may suggest this tactic will only reinforce the ever-growing notion that porn is not worth paying for, Braun told AVN, "My approach is quite different, fans are actually paying for it, so they are showing that there still is a value for quality product. As a matter of fact, they are solely responsible for this movie ever being made."

The $500,000 goal for Empire's budget is equal to that of Star Wars XXX, and would cover the cost of production, marketing, Indiegogo fees and crowdfunding perks, which include premiere party tickets, signed scripts, costumes and props from the movie, set visits and more.

Pre-production and set construction is scheduled to begin April 26, with a projected 28-day shooting schedule starting June 1 and taking place in California, Nevada and Alaska.

"There was simply no way to do justice to the movie without real snow, and Alaska offers the perfect landscape for bringing Hoth to life," Braun explained in regard to the latter far-flung location. "So we'll pack up and go freeze our butts over there for a week in the middle of June. The good news is that a visit to our Alaska set is one of the many perks that we're offering in the campaign, which means two lucky fans may get to share that awesomely hypothermic experience with us."

The Empire Strikes Back XXX: An Axel Braun Parody will feature returning Star Wars XXX cast members Allie Haze (Princess Leia), Lexington Steele (Darth Vader) and Seth Gamble (Luke Skywalker), as well as new cast additions Riley Steele, Carter Cruise, Aiden Ashley, Casey Calvert and Asa Akira, on special loan from Wicked Pictures. Braun's longtime collaborator Eli Cross will also return as a producer and director of photography. Additional cast members will be added as the fundraising campaign progresses.

Pending the success of the funding campaign, Braun plans to release The Empire Strikes Back XXX September 30, 2016.
